Yay! Green Light for Poultry Shows & Embryology.

Poultry Shows and 4-H Embryology Are Back!

Poultry shows and 4-H Embryology have been given the green light from state veterinarian Mike Martin after hiatus due to Bird Flu. Please see the news release from NCDA for more details.
